                        Guys, you do realise that there can't be any overlap between techs right? You can't have a titan and a mechmarine on the same hotkey since you can build both with the same factory. The current hotkey layout, besides few weird key choices like mass fabs, is already quite optimised and intuitive as each row of qaz corresponds to one tech tier

                                    That seems slower than the current solution. Whst about queueing large amounts of units. If click the key too fast before the mouse button u will end up with wrong units. Also if the unit i want is the 3rd option and i want 4 units, thats 12 key presses and 4 mouse presses compared to the 4 using the current system. At that point just use normal clicking of the icon.
